NFL Agent Drew Rosenhaus’ Daring Shark Encounter

In a scenario that seems to have come straight out of an adventure film, Drew Rosenhaus, a renowned sports agent who handles multi-million dollar NFL contracts, engaged in an unusual activity.

Based in Miami Beach, Rosenhaus joined star receiver Tyreek Hill on a boat trip on Tuesday, where they encountered a dusky shark in the open sea. Rosenhaus seized the opportunity for a daring photo-op.

Adorned with snorkeling gear, the sports agent plunged into the water, ignoring the boat captain’s cautionary shouts, “Don’t grab him, Drew! We don’t have that kind of insurance”. Undeterred by the warning, Rosenhaus gripped the shark’s tail, shouting, “Take a picture,” through his snorkel.

When the boat captain asked Tyreek Hill if he wanted to plunge into the water too, the Dolphins star promptly replied with a resolute “hell no.”

The Danger of Dusky Sharks

Due to their considerable size, dusky sharks are often viewed as potentially threatening humans. However, incidents involving these creatures are relatively rare. Despite the scant number of encounters, Rosenhaus has faced criticism for disregarding the potential risks of interacting with the nine-foot sea creature.

Marine life experts, weighing in on the incident pointed out that a healthy and lively dusky shark would have displayed much more resistance, possibly even attacking Rosenhaus. They contended that the shark in this encounter was likely tired, as suggested by its sluggish swimming pattern.

Rosenhaus’ Shark Encounter

In another video clip of the incident, Hill exclaims at his agent, “Drew, what the hell are you doing?”. The boat captain reiterated his earlier sentiment and said, “A real Florida Man right here.”

The unusual incident and Rosenhaus’ fearless conduct have stirred discussions and raised eyebrows on social media, highlighting the risks and responsibilities when humans interact with marine wildlife.
